Residential construction prices have been a focal point for owners, builders, and contractors alike, especially within the ever-evolving housing market. With factors similar to labor shortages, material costs, and financial conditions playing pivotal roles, understanding these prices could make a major difference in project planning and execution.
When embarking on a residential construction project, estimating costs is normally a daunting task. Various elements contribute to the overall expenditure, including land acquisition, design, materials, labor, permits, and overhead costs. Each of those parts can vary significantly relying on the project's size, location, and complexity.
The design stage is crucial as it sets the tone for the whole project. Architects and designers normally charge charges primarily based on the overall scope of work. High-quality designs can lead to increased construction prices, whereas extra straightforward designs might come with a lesser price tag. Selecting the proper design may help mitigate different costs, as a well-thought-out plan can streamline the development course of.
Land acquisition prices can fluctuate drastically primarily based in the marketplace and location. Areas experiencing rapid development often see skyrocketing land prices. This can significantly influence the whole residential construction prices. In areas the place land is scarce or in high demand, potential homeowners might find themselves dealing with a troublesome market where the affordability of land becomes a considerable challenge.

Material prices are one other important aspect of residential construction prices. Homebuilders should maintain abreast of those adjustments to develop budgets that replicate current market conditions
Common materials such as lumber, steel, and concrete have all confronted value fluctuations. For occasion, the value of lumber saw an unprecedented spike through the peak of the COVID-19 pandemic. Although prices have since stabilized, they still stay higher than pre-pandemic levels. Builders should consider these modifications and their potential impact on overall expenditures when planning a construction project.

Labor costs are also a major contributor to residential construction prices. The construction trade has confronted a talented labor shortage for the past a number of years. As demand for housing will increase, the provision of certified staff decreases, leading to higher wages. Contractors must offer aggressive salaries to draw and maintain expert laborers, which instantly impacts the budget of residential construction tasks.
Another factor that frequently will get overlooked in construction estimates is the price of permits and inspections. Each locality has different regulations and necessities concerning construction, and these can add vital prices to a project. Obtaining the mandatory permits usually includes charges and extra prices for professional services to ensure compliance with native building codes.
Finishing prices, which embody every little thing from paint to flooring, can even have a considerable impression on general residential construction costs. Homeowners often want to personalize their spaces, resulting in higher-end finishes that can push budgets past preliminary estimates. Carefully selecting finishes based mostly on both aesthetic desires and budget constraints may help maintain monetary targets.
The unpredictable nature of the true estate market can significantly affect residential construction prices as properly. Interest rates, financial growth, and demographic developments influence housing demand. When demand exceeds supply, construction prices are most likely to rise, further straining budgets. Builders and owners need to remain informed about market developments to make strategic selections throughout the development process.

- Fluctuations in material prices can significantly influence general residential construction prices, often driven by market demand and provide chain disruptions.
- Local labor market conditions play a crucial position; regions with expert labor shortages might experience higher wage rates, growing the project's complete expenditure.
- Site preparation costs—such as grading, excavation, and environmental assessments—should be factored into the overall budget as they will differ based mostly on land circumstances.
- Sustainability features, like solar panels and energy-efficient appliances, can raise initial bills however might lead to long-term savings through reduced utility payments.
- Design complexity influences prices; custom-built properties typically require extra assets and time in comparability with normal designs, leading to higher costs.
- Regulatory requirements and building codes can add unforeseen costs; permits and inspections could require extra budget allocation to make sure compliance.
- Homeowners should budget for contingency costs of round 10-20% of the entire project to cover sudden expenses or adjustments throughout construction.
- The selection of finishes and fixtures can dramatically alter the budget, with high-end materials significantly elevating projected construction costs.
- Financing phrases affect construction prices; interest rates on loans can enhance or lower the overall expense of a residential building project.

What components affect residential construction costs?undefinedSeveral factors affect residential construction costs, including location, dimension of the project, materials used, design complexities, labor costs, and regulatory necessities. Understanding these elements may help owners better estimate their budgets.
How can I estimate the price of building a house?undefinedTo estimate the cost of building a home, think about consulting with local builders for quotes and utilizing online calculators. Additionally, evaluate prices of land, materials, labor, permits, and utilities to create a complete budget.

Are there hidden prices associated with residential construction?undefinedYes, hidden prices typically arise throughout residential construction, such as sudden site points, changes in design, allowing fees, and utility connections. It's clever to put aside a contingency fund to cover these potential bills.
How can I reduce my residential construction costs?undefinedReducing residential construction prices can be achieved by choosing cost-effective materials, simplifying the design, and hiring experienced contractors. Additionally, cautious planning and efficient project management may help keep bills in check.
What is the typical cost per sq. foot for residential construction?undefinedThe common cost per sq. foot varies significantly primarily based on location and materials but typically ranges from $100 to $200 for basic construction. Custom houses or luxurious builds can exceed these averages significantly.
How do labor costs have an effect on residential construction budgets?undefinedLabor costs are a good portion of residential construction budgets, typically starting from 20% to 50% of the total cost. Rates can differ based on the area, project complexity, and labor market demand, impacting total spending.

What permits do I need for residential construction?undefinedPermits required for residential construction sometimes embody building permits, electrical permits, plumbing permits, and zoning approvals. Check with your local municipality for specific requirements, as they'll vary extensively.
When ought to I expect to see cost overruns during construction?undefinedCost overruns can happen throughout any phase of construction because of modifications in design, unexpected site circumstances, or fluctuations in material prices. It’s essential to keep up communication together with your contractor and often monitor expenses.
Is financing available for residential construction projects?undefinedYes, financing choices are available for residential construction projects, including construction loans, house equity loans, and conventional mortgages. Each possibility has its phrases and eligibility criteria, so researching is essential to find the most effective fit.
